#やりたいこと
まず,pythonの1つのリストから,順序を維持したまま重複している要素を削除します。
その後,他のリストにて,削除した位置と同じ位置の要素を削除したいです。
#実行例
具体的な実行例を以下に示します。
ここではリストaとリストbの2つのリストがあり,中身は以下の通りです。
a=[2,1,2,3]
b=[a,b,c,d]
この場合に,リストaで重複している要素を順序を維持したまま削除し,リストaで削除した要素の位置と同じ位置のリストbの要素を削除したいです。
削除後は以下のようになります。
a=[2,1,3]
b=[a,b,d]
削除後の両リストを見ると,リストaの重複していた2が削除され,リストbでは,同じ位置の要素'c'が消えています。
pythonでのこの処理を行うコードを教えてください。
よろしくお願いします。
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2021/10/07 05:53
退会済みユーザー
2021/10/07 06:28